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8726 2593936 1296
29 8498557 49152078647
29 8498557 49152078647
298537 373 46934
All about undefined
Interested in learning more?
29 8498557 49152078647
298537 373 46934
See more
471643934 969 3178148
75792608292 911649 1220113 11 933
See more
78851 1960293 98684017274
46290 23236 75078 96
See more